THE FUND SYSTEM WITH IN‑KIND OFFSET (complete version)
1. BOTH PARTNERS PAY INTO ONE FUND This is the petty‑cash pool This is the neutral zone This is the relationship bank No guilt No scoreboard
2. ANYTIME YOU GO OUT OR SPLURGE You borrow from the fund Not from each other This keeps the emotional temperature low This keeps the flow steady
3. PAYBACK IS SIMPLE You refill the fund later You both keep it alive You both treat it like training Training to borrow Training to pay back Training to keep flow instead of fear
4. HERO MOMENTS ARE TRAINING If one partner covers the other If one partner steps up If one partner splurges It is NOT a debt It is NOT leverage It is NOT a power move It is TRAINING Training to support Training to refill Training to stay balanced
5. IF ONE PARTNER EARNS MORE This is where your new idea fits perfectly The lesser earner can offset the imbalance with in‑kind services This keeps dignity This keeps equality This keeps contribution flowing even when money isn’t equal
